Code P0B48 Chevrolet Description
The battery energy control module monitors the voltage of the 96 battery cell groups through the four hybrid/EV battery interface control modules. Voltage sense circuits are attached to each individual cell group, and these sense circuits terminate at a connector located on the top surface of the battery section. A serviceable auxiliary battery wiring harness joins this connector to a hybrid/EV battery interface control module, also located on the top surface of the battery section. The hybrid/EV battery interface control module encodes the voltage reading and transmits it to the battery energy control module through the battery control harness. There is one hybrid/EV battery interface control module located on battery sections one and two, and two hybrid/EV battery interface control modules associated with battery section three. The hybrid/EV battery interface control module, battery energy control module wiring harness, auxiliary battery wiring harness, and battery energy control module are all considered serviceable components.
The battery energy control module will determine when a fault condition is present. Diagnostics and system status are communicated from the battery energy control module to hybrid/EV powertrain control module 2 through serial data. The hybrid/EV powertrain control module 2 is the host controller for diagnostic trouble code information.
What are the Possible Causes of the DTC P0B48 Chevrolet?
- Faulty Hybrid/Electric Vehicle Battery Pack
- Faulty Hybrid/Electric Vehicle Battery Interface Control Module
How to Fix the DTC P0B48 Chevrolet?
Review the 'Possible Causes' above and visually examine the corresponding wiring harness and connectors. Check for damaged components and inspect connector pins for signs of being broken, bent, pushed out, or corroded.

Frequently Asked Questions about P0B48 Chevrolet Code
1. What does the OBDII code P0B48 mean on a Chevrolet?
P0B48 indicates a high voltage issue in the circuit of the hybrid or electric vehicle battery module 3, which is part of the battery management system.
2. What are the common symptoms of the P0B48 code?
Symptoms may include an illuminated check engine light, reduced fuel efficiency, limited power output, or the vehicle entering limp mode.
3. What causes the P0B48 code on a Chevrolet?
Common causes include a faulty battery module, damaged voltage sensors, corroded or loose wiring, or issues with the battery control module.
4. Can I drive my Chevrolet with the P0B48 code?
It is not recommended to drive with this code active, as it could lead to further damage to the hybrid battery system or cause the vehicle to lose power unexpectedly.
5. How is the P0B48 code diagnosed?
A technician will use a scan tool to confirm the code, inspect the wiring and connectors in the battery system, and test the voltage levels of the affected battery module.
6. How do you fix the P0B48 code on a Chevrolet?
Repairs may involve replacing the faulty battery module, repairing or replacing damaged wiring, or reprogramming the battery control module.
7. Can low battery coolant levels cause the P0B48 code?
Yes, insufficient battery coolant can lead to overheating, which may trigger high voltage issues and the P0B48 code.
8. What is the cost to repair the P0B48 code on a Chevrolet?
The repair cost varies but can range from $300 for wiring repairs to over $1,000 for battery module replacement, depending on the extent of the issue.
9. Can a weak 12-volt auxiliary battery cause the P0B48 code?
While rare, a weak 12-volt battery can cause communication errors in the hybrid system, potentially triggering related codes.
10. How can I prevent the P0B48 code from occurring again?
Regular maintenance of the hybrid battery system, ensuring proper coolant levels, and addressing electrical issues promptly can help prevent this code from recurring.
